The Nissan Z gets the NISMO, as in Nissan Motorsports International, treatment in 2024 with an increase in performance, and price. Horsepower for the twin-turbo 3.0-liter V-6 engine is up 5 percent from 400 to 420. Torque is up 10 percent from 350 to 384 lb-ft. The price is up too. The 2024 Z NISMO starts at CAD $75,998, a 22 percent premium over the Z Performance’s $61,998 MSRP and a 49 percent jump over the $50,998 Z Sport. The Z NISMO is much more TrackWorthy than the Z Sport and Z Performance.
In addition to the increase in horsepower and torque, what else do you get for $75,998? One is exclusivity, as this is a limited-availability car. What you don’t get is a 6 speed manual transmission. It is only available with a 9 speed automatic transmission with paddle shifters. It has revised clutch packs for faster shifting to make it more suited for track days. Downshift times have been cut in half compared to the automatic in the Z Performance. In addition to Normal and Sport, the Z NISMO adds a new Sport+ drive mode.

The 2024 Nissan Z NISMO is available in five colours: Black Diamond Pearl, Brilliant Silver, Passion Red TriCoat, Everest White Pearl TriCoat and the NISMO-exclusive Stealth Grey.
